Fast Codes

WARNING: This page is about a different car, the 1994 Mercury Sable, 1994 Mercury Cougar, 1994 Lincoln Continental, 1994 Ford Thunderbird, and 1994 Ford Taurus. However, it is still accessible from the selected car via links, so may be relevant.

At start of KOEO SELF-TEST and after Wide Open Throttle (WOT) request in KOER SELF-TEST, PCM outputs short bursts of information, known as FAST CODES, which were used by manufacturer during assembly. These codes contain the identical information as slow codes, but are transmitted at 100 times the normal rate. With most equipment (except Super Star II tester), these code bursts are not visible. An entire code sequence lasts less than 1/2 second.
